France wins men’s epee gold
BEIJING: France won the team gold medal in men’s epee fencing on Friday, easily defeating Poland in the title bout.
The French trio of Jerome Jeannet, Fabrice Jeannet and Ulrich Robeiri won 45-29. Fabrice Jeannet, the individual silver medallist, outscored his opponents 17-7. After he won five straight points against Radoslaw Zawrotniak, France led 30-14. He later returned to win seven of the final 11 points to clinch the title.
Poland took the silver and Italy won the bronze.
France also won the men’s epee title in 2004. This was Poland’s first medal in the event since 1980. — AP
